What Is Pressure Washing and How Does It Work?

Pressure washing uses high-pressure water jets to remove stubborn dirt, moss, mould, and debris. It is often recommended for:

  • Terracotta tiles

  • Concrete tiles

  • Older roofs with heavy organic growth

Benefits of Pressure Washing for Roof Cleaning

Pressure washing is a popular choice for roof cleaning Brighton East due to its ability to deliver instant and visible results. Key advantages include:

  • Removes thick moss and lichen

  • Restores original roof colour

  • Prepares the surface for sealing or roof painting

  • Works well on durable tile roofs

When Pressure Washing May Not Be Suitable

Although effective, pressure washing is not suitable for every roof. It can be too harsh for:

  • Metal or Colorbond roofs

  • Delicate or brittle tiles

  • Older roofs needing repairs

This is why roofing specialists assess the roof’s condition before recommending a method.

What Is Soft Wash Roof Cleaning?

Soft washing uses eco-friendly detergents combined with low-pressure water to gently dissolve dirt, algae, mould, and stains. It’s a safer method designed to protect delicate roof materials.

Benefits of Soft Washing for Brighton East Homes

Soft wash services are widely recommended because they:

  • Kill mould and algae at the root

  • Prevent rapid regrowth

  • Protect roof coatings and sealants

  • Are ideal for metal and Colorbond roofs

Pressure Washing vs Soft Wash — Which Method Is Best?

Choosing between pressure washing and soft washing depends on your roof type, age, and level of dirt buildup.

1. For Tile Roofs

Pressure washing is usually more effective because it removes thick moss and stubborn buildups. It is often followed by sealing or roof painting Brighton East to restore surface protection.

2. For Colorbond or Metal Roofs

Soft washing is the preferred method because it prevents scratches, dents and coating damage. It also stops mould growth, which is common in coastal suburbs like Brighton East.

3. For Heavily Contaminated Roofs

A combination of both methods may be used—soft wash for treatment and pressure wash for removal.

4. For Older or Fragile Roofs

Soft washing is the safer option, delivering a thorough clean without structural damage.

Should You Clean Your Roof Before Roof Painting?

Absolutely. Roof cleaning is the first essential step before painting or restoration. Dirt, algae and mould can prevent paint from bonding correctly.
